FLOWERY BRANCH, Ga. — Kemal Ishmael has filled William Moore's strong safety job fairly well this season for the Atlanta Falcons. Robert McClain has essentially done the same for injured cornerback Robert Alford the last five games. Now if the secondary can make it through this week without losing another starter, the Falcons like their chances to beat Carolina and win the weak NFC South.
